我已经在FlutterFlow中构建了一个应用程序,并将其导出到Xcode中,以便构建一个应用程序包,用于商店上传。
我已经为iPhone安装了所有的应用程序依赖项,Flutter,X1 E1 F1 X和iOS模拟器。
我已经使用我的Apple Developer帐户设置了签名帐户,在Xcode中设置了开发团队,并注册了应用程序捆绑包标识符。
然后,在Runner中完成所有设置后,我在Xcode v15.0.1中运行该应用程序,并将其设置为在iOS 17.0的iPhone 15模拟器中运行。
构建过程完全完成,没有任何问题。
然后,当应用程序被发送到iPhone模拟器运行时,它只显示一个白色,以及这些错误消息:
Error Domain=NSCocoaErrorDomain Code=4099 "The connection to service named com.apple.commcenter.coretelephony.xpc was invalidated: failed at lookup with error 3 - No such process." UserInfo={NSDebugDescription=The connection to service named com.apple.commcenter.coretelephony.xpc was invalidated: failed at lookup with error 3 - No such process.}
个字符
然后关闭应用程序启动,并使用SIGABRT显示线程。
第一条消息是关于核心电话服务的。
第二个问题似乎与Skia(Flutter的图形渲染库)有关,但没有指出原因。
导致此问题的原因是什么?如何解决?
我试过检查所有的运行程序设置,并试图直接从终端运行“flutter build ios”命令,这也不起作用,并说要使用Xcode中的“产品/运行”。
我已经多次尝试清理构建文件夹并重新构建,但没有任何更改。
该应用程序使用Firebase(一个名为“ImageNotifcation”的子部分运行器目标)进行通知。
我已经变更建置阶段设定来解决先前的问题,它们的顺序如下:
1.目标相关性
1.运行生成工具插件
1.检查Pod清单锁定
1.嵌入式框架
1.嵌入应用程序扩展
1.嵌入式Pod框架
1.运行脚本
1.编译源代码
1.将二进制文件与库链接
1.复制捆绑包资源
1.精简二进制
1.复制窗格资源
2条答案
按热度按时间e5nszbig1#
此问题与iOS上的叶轮渲染引擎有关。请检查此link
试着像下面这样不使用叶轮运行
字符串
23c0lvtd2#
将此代码添加到info.plist文件中
字符串
然后你就可以正常运行你的代码了。这对我很有效